Becton, Dickinson and Company: 33 sponsored US clinical trials, 1 recruiting.

Becton, Dickinson and Company sponsors 33 registered US clinical trials on ClinicalTrials.gov, 1 of them currently recruiting, and 28 completed. 0 of these trials are in Phase 3-4 (later-stage) and 3 in Phase 1-2 (earlier-stage). The most-studied condition in this pipeline is Peripheral Intavenous Catheter Stabilization, with 1 trials.

Trial completion reliability score

D 58/100

28 of 32 decided trials (Completed vs. Terminated on ClinicalTrials.gov) reached their planned completion (87.5%), vs. national p10 68.4% / p90 100% among 1,234 sponsors with at least 10 decided trials. Still-open trials (Recruiting, Active-not-recruiting, Not-yet-recruiting) are excluded since they have not reached an outcome yet.
